Water Play Extravaganza

Embrace the refreshing power of water to keep your little ones cool and engaged. Transform your backyard into a water wonderland with a variety of water-based activities that will have them giggling and splashing the day away.Unleash the excitement of "Water Balloon Baseball" by filling up water balloons and using them as baseballs. When the batter hits the balloon, it bursts, creating a delightful splash. This game not only provides a cooling respite but also encourages physical activity and friendly competition.For those without access to a pool, create a DIY "Splash Pad" in your backyard. Secure a large plastic tarp to the ground with stakes and add a sprinkler or two. Kids can slide, splash, and dance on the wet surface, staying cool and entertained for hours on end.Take the classic game of tag to the next level with "Water Gun Tag." Equip your kids with water guns and let them chase each other around, tagging by squirting water instead of touch. This water-filled twist on a beloved game will keep them laughing and refreshed.

Indoor Activities for Scorching Days

When the sun's rays become too intense, retreat indoors and unleash your creativity. Transform your living space into a hub of cool and engaging activities that will captivate your little ones.Construct an "Indoor Obstacle Course" using pillows, chairs, and blankets. Challenge your kids to crawl under tables, jump over cushions, and balance on taped lines. This active indoor adventure will keep them moving and entertained, all while staying out of the heat.Embrace the world of cool crafts and projects. Unleash their imagination by creating "Ice Art," where you freeze small toys or objects in blocks of ice and let them chip away to discover the hidden treasures. Alternatively, set up a homemade "Sensory Bin" filled with cool water beads or chilled rice, providing a tactile and soothing experience.For a relaxing respite, transform your living room into a cozy "Movie Marathon" haven. Draw the curtains, make some popcorn, and enjoy a lineup of your kids' favorite films. This is the perfect way to unwind and escape the scorching temperatures.

Exploring Nature's Cool Spots

Venture out and discover the refreshing oases that nature has to offer. Embrace the cooling embrace of natural water bodies, shaded trails, and underground sanctuaries.Seek out local "Natural Water Bodies" like lakes, rivers, and waterfalls. These natural cooling spots often provide a more refreshing experience than swimming pools, while also offering a scenic backdrop for a day of fun. Pack a picnic, bring water toys, and let your kids splash and play in the rejuvenating waters.For a more serene experience, plan "Early Morning or Evening Hikes." Avoid the midday heat by scheduling your outdoor adventures during the cooler hours. Choose shaded trails and bring plenty of water and snacks. Exploring nature during these times can be a peaceful and rejuvenating experience for both you and your little ones.Venture underground and discover the natural air conditioning of "Cave Explorations." Caves maintain cooler temperatures, making them an excellent destination for a hot summer day. Check out local caves or caverns that offer guided tours, and let your kids be captivated by the stalactites and stalagmites while enjoying the refreshing underground climate.
